Octopus Go rates in West Midlands
West Midlands: 32.02p daytime / 9.5p overnightOn the current Octopus Go 12-month fixed tariff (GO-FIX-12M-26-03-23), households in West Midlands pay 32.02p/kWh during the day and 9.5p/kWh overnight (00:30–05:30), with a standing charge of 57.35p/day. The off-peak rate is the same across all regions; the daytime rate varies.
For comparison, the standard variable tariff in West Midlands is 23.89p/kWh (Ofgem cap, Q2 2026) – a flat rate with no cheap overnight window.
This covers postcodes: B, CV, DY, HR, ST, TF, WR, WS, WV – including Birmingham, Coventry, Wolverhampton, Stoke-on-Trent. Your distribution network operator is National Grid Electricity Distribution.

Your savings with an 11.5kWh battery
The battery charges overnight at 9.5p and powers your home during the day, avoiding the 32.02p daytime rate. The saving is the difference between those rates, multiplied by how much energy the battery delivers each cycle.

(32.02p daytime − 9.5p overnight) × 10.35kWh = 233p saved per day
233p × 365 days = £851/year
Rates from the Octopus Energy API (product GO-FIX-12M-26-03-23, April 2026). Assumes one full battery cycle per day. Actual savings depend on your usage patterns.
How West Midlands compares
The Octopus Go off-peak rate (9.5p) is the same everywhere, but the daytime rate varies by region – so regions with higher daytime rates see bigger savings.
| Region | Go daytime rate | Spread | Annual saving |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Wales | 31.67p | 22.2p | £838 |
| West Midlands | 32.02p | 22.5p | £851 |
| East Midlands | 32.32p | 22.8p | £862 |
| Northern England | 32.36p | 22.9p | £864 |
| London | 32.64p | 23.1p | £874 |
| South West England | 33.15p | 23.6p | £893 |
| Northern Scotland | 33.72p | 24.2p | £915 |
| North West England | 33.75p | 24.2p | £916 |
| South East England | 33.87p | 24.4p | £921 |
| Eastern England | 34.32p | 24.8p | £938 |
| Southern England | 34.42p | 24.9p | £941 |
| Yorkshire | 34.49p | 25.0p | £944 |
| Southern Scotland | 34.54p | 25.0p | £946 |
| North Wales & Merseyside | 35.73p | 26.2p | £991 |
